SAUSAGE AND MASH RECIPE - BBC FOOD



Sausage and mash recipe - BBC Food image

The classic sausage and mash served with homemade onion gravy and peas. Simple and sure to please all the family. This is designed to be a low cost recipe.

Provided by Tom Kerridge

Prep Time 30 minutes

Cook Time 30 minutes

Yield Serves 4

Number Of Ingredients 12

8 sausages
2 onions, sliced
½ tsp dried mixed herbs
½ tsp English mustard
600ml/20fl oz stock (ideally beef, although chicken or vegetable is fine)
salt and black pepper
2 tsp softened butter
2 tsp plain flour
900g/2lb potatoes, peeled and chopped into equally sized cubes
50g/1¾oz butter
100ml/3½fl oz milk
300g/10½oz frozen peas

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 200C/180C Fan/Gas 6.
  • Put the sausages in a roasting tin and place in the preheated oven. Cook for 10 minutes then turn the sausages and cook for a further 5 minutes, or until they have a good colour on the outside.
  • Add the sliced onions to the tin. Mix the dried herbs, mustard and stock together and pour over the sausages and onions. Return the tin to the oven for a further 20 minutes, or until the sausages are cooked through and the onion gravy thickened. Season to taste with salt and pepper.
  • For the mash, boil the potatoes in a pan of boiling water until tender. Drain and mash.
  • Heat the butter and milk until the butter has melted. Add a pinch of salt and pepper then pour over the mashed potato and mix until smooth. Set aside until ready to serve.
  • Cook the peas in a saucepan of boiling water for 2–3 minutes, or steam them for 1–2 minutes. Drain thoroughly and set aside.
  • For the sausages and onion gravy, mix the softened butter and plain flour together to form a paste. Remove the sausages from the baking tray, set aside and cover to keep warm. Place the baking tray onto the hob, add the flour and butter mixture and whisk until combined. Stir over a medium-high heat for 2–3 minutes, or until the gravy has thickened slightly. Add the sausages back to the tray and warm through for 1–2 minutes.
  • Serve the sausages, mash and peas with the onion gravy spooned over.

SWEET POTATO MASH RECIPE | BBC GOOD FOOD



Sweet potato mash recipe | BBC Good Food image

Swap regular mash for a sweet potato version, full of vitamin C and fibre. It's great as a topping for shepherd's pie or fish pie, or as a veggie side dish

Provided by Lulu Grimes

Categories     Side dish

Total Time 12 minutes

Prep Time 2 minutes

Cook Time 10 minutes

Yield 2

Number Of Ingredients 2

500g sweet potatoes , peeled and cubed
2 tbsp butter

Steps:

  • Boil the potatoes in salted water for 10 mins or until tender, how long they take will depend on the size of the cubes. Drain very well and leave to steam dry for a couple of minutes.
  • Tip the potatoes back into the pan and mash with 1 tbsp butter using a fork or masher, then season well. Serve with the extra butter and more seasoning on top.

SMASHED CELERIAC RECIPE | JAMIE OLIVER CELERIAC RECIPES
What a surprisingly simple and comforting veg dish. Unfortunately everyone seems to be completely baffled by celeriac, but it's beautiful in soups or thinly sliced into salads. When roasted it goes sweet and when mixed with potato and mashed it's a complete joy. Here, mash the celeriac just a little bit so you've got a gorgeous sort-of-in-between smash-up
From jamieoliver.com
Total Time 40 minutes
Cuisine https://schema.org/LowLactoseDiet, https://schema.org/GlutenFreeDiet, https://schema.org/VeganDiet, https://schema.org/VegetarianDiet
Calories 153 calories per serving
    1. Peel the celeriac, then slice about 1cm/½ inch off the bottom of it and roll it on to that flat edge, so it's nice and safe to slice. Slice and dice it all up into 1cm/½ inch-ish cubes. Don't get your ruler out – they don't have to be perfect.
    2. Put a casserole-type pot on a high heat, add 3 good lugs of olive oil, then add the celeriac. Pick in the thyme leaves and peel and finely chop the garlic, and add both with a little sea salt and black pepper. Stir around to coat and fry quite fast, giving a little colour, for 5 minutes.
    3. Turn the heat down to a simmer, add the water or stock, place a lid on top and cook for around 25 minutes, until tender.
    4. Season carefully to taste and stir around with a spoon to smash up the celeriac. Some people like to keep it in cubes, some like to mash it, but I think it looks and tastes much better if you smash it, which is somewhere in the middle. You can serve this with just about any meat you can think of.
